About
Anthony Meier is pleased to present Bay Area Music Village, a solo exhibition of new work by Los Angeles-based artist Dave Muller, opening reception Saturday 16 November from 2 - 4 pm. Renowned for an oeuvre informed by a lifelong fascination with music and its power to shape identity and cultural dialogue, this exhibition represents a homecoming for the artist as it explores the vibrant cultural landscape of his roots in the Bay Area.
SF/Arts Curator Insight
As a music fanboy, I have long loved LA-based Dave Muller's work. His "Top Tens," human-size paintings of record album spines, function as self- portraits. Objects we obsess over, that we have and continue to cherish, often say more about us than words could ever express. Disco mirror balls of various sizes reflect various landscapes seen through colored lights (and colored glasses.) A hand-painted mural evoking the artist's Bay Area childhood covers the walls. Transforming the gallery into a scrap book, DJ booth, and record store? Yes, please.

Anthony Meier
Anthony Meier was established in 1984 as a private dealer in the secondary market. Working with both public and private collections, Anthony Meier built a highly regarded international reputation specializing in post- World War II contemporary masters.
